Question

How many terms of the geometric sequence 3,3,33,........ must be taken to make the sum 39+133?

Solution

Given for the geometric series the first term is 3 and the common ratio is also 3.
Let us take n terms to have the given sum.
Then by the problem,
3(3)n131=39+133
or, 3{(3)n1}=263
or, (3)n=27
or, n=6.
